"We are back" « oc.at

Proxmox VMs, Storage, usw.

creative2k 15.02.2024 - 01:00 29416 106 Thread rating
Posts

stevke

in the bin
Avatar
Registered: Sep 2001
Location: Wien
Posts: 3964
Bis auf OpenWRT und dem Logitech Media Server hab ich ein ähnliches Setup (dafür noch paar andere Container auf Proxmox) auf einem S740 laufen, der fadisiert sich dabei ziemlich.
OpenWRT rennt auf einem Pi4 mit USB-NIC (300 Mbit Kabel Internet) und hab keine Probleme damit, würde es theoretisch auch gerne auf eine Maschine zusammenlegen, aber die Abhängigkeit vom Router-OS auf einem "Bastel"-Server is halt schon ein Nachteil.

RIDDLER

Dual CPU-Fetischist
Avatar
Registered: Dec 2002
Location: Wien
Posts: 1899
Zum Basteln sollte man eh einen eigenen Server verwenden, sonst wird es mühsam.

stevke

in the bin
Avatar
Registered: Sep 2001
Location: Wien
Posts: 3964
Basteln is übertrieben, aber hie und da ein Reboot, auch auf Grund von Updates, ist halt trotzdem notwendig. Kann man sich aber auch so einteilen da grad niemand streamt :)

Viper780

Elder
Er ist tot, Jim!
Avatar
Registered: Mar 2001
Location: Wien
Posts: 50289
wenn du mit dem Storage auskommst würd ich alles auf dem S740 laufen lassen.

CPU Leistung wirst du nicht viel benötigen (maximal für Jellyfin transcodieren wenn das aktiv ist)

Router (OPNsense, pfSense, OpenWRT,....) würde ich dann auf einen der S920 geben.
Der hat auch eine PCIe Schnittstelle wo du entsprechende DualNIC oder QuadNIC mit offloading einsetzen kannst.

OpenWRT ist bei mir schon eine Zeit her und hauptsächlich wegen WiFi fuktionalität.
OPNsense hat im Bereich Firewall eine umfangreichere GUI und lässt darüber etwas mehr Konfiguration zu. Da deine Kisten stark genug für OPNsense oder pfsense sind würde ich eher darauf setzen. Aber auch das ist vorallem eine Gewohnheitsfrage

Was machst du aktuell dass du einen R7 3700X benötigst?

@davebastard
guter Punkt, war ja der Start hier. Damit auslagern.

davebastard

Vinyl-Sammler
Avatar
Registered: Jun 2002
Location: wean
Posts: 12393
Zitat
Zum Basteln sollte man eh einen eigenen Server verwenden, sonst wird es mühsam.

es ist ja nicht nur basteln, es ist ja auch wie Schizo gesagt hat bitter wenn am Server irgendwas ned funzt und man dadurch neben dem Fehler auch noch damit kämpfen muss das man kein Internet zum recherchieren hat... aber das ist eh eine Grundsatzentscheidung die jeder selber treffen muss, die Problematik aufzeigen ist aber sicher ned verkehrt.

Seh es wie Stevke, nachdem die raspberrypis schon da sind könntest wirklich das mal verwenden und für den Server den S740. Wenn die Leistung vom thinclient nicht reicht kann man noch immer upgraden auf den 3700x

eventuell gibts für das cm4 ein erweiterungsboard für 2 NICs?

edit:@viper seinen post, ja ob s920 oder raspi würd dich dann davon abhängig machen was weniger verbraucht

edit2: wegen openwrt vs opnsense. ich würds auch so sehen dass openwrt vor allem dann die vorteile hat wenns um geflashte router geht wo auch das wifi schon eingebaut ist. ABER für diesen einfachen fall können es trotzdem beide ohne probleme. würde sogar sagen das alles über die GUI geht. für wireguard muss man halt über den (grafischen) paketmanager das paket für wireguard und dessen gui installieren.
Bearbeitet von davebastard am 12.01.2025, 15:01

schizo

Produkt der Gesellschaft
Avatar
Registered: Feb 2003
Location: Vienna
Posts: 2564
Ich hab derzeit openwrt auf meinen APs und OPNsense am Router laufen, somit in beides etwas Einblick.
OPNsense macht am Router deutlich mehr Sinn. Ist ja nicht nur das GUI, sondern es gibt deutlich mehr Pakete, die ggf. am Router nützlich sind. Auch wenn du eine Firewall konfigurieren magst ist das Trouble Shooting bei nicht funktionierenden Verbindung einfacher als bei openwrt.

KruzFX

8.10.2021
Avatar
Registered: Aug 2005
Location: ZDR
Posts: 2084
Wie siehts mit der Performance von OPNsense aus? Ich hatte anfangs pfsense statt OpenWRT laufen, das hat aber nicht mal die 80Mbit von meinem ISP geschafft, nur die Hälfte. Darum bin ich dann auf OpenWRT geswitcht. OpenWRT hab ich ebenfalls auf sämtlichen APs laufen, funktioniert ziemlich problemlos.

Zwecks Ausfallssicherheit vom Server, wäre ja auch ein Proxmox HA-Cluster aus den beiden S920 möglich, wenn die performancemäßig nicht so schlecht ausgestattet wären =D. Einer der zahlreichen RPis im Haus macht dann noch das Quorum...

schizo

Produkt der Gesellschaft
Avatar
Registered: Feb 2003
Location: Vienna
Posts: 2564
Performancemäßig solltest du hier keine Probleme haben. Ich kenne Berichte, laut welchen auf einem RPi4 Transferraten von ~300MBit möglich sind. Die Thinclients sollten hier besser performen.
Ein HA Cluster hilft natürlich bei unerwarteten Ausfällen, komplett negieren kannst du das Risiko eines Totalausfalls zwar auch nicht, die meisten Problemfälle, die mir jetzt gerade allerdings einfallen würdest du damit erschlagen können.

hynk

Vereinsmitglied
like totally ambivalent
Avatar
Registered: Apr 2003
Location: Linz
Posts: 11077
Du kannst das Quorum auch auf 2 runter drehen.
Alternativ kannst du auch qdevice auf einem anderen Gerät laufen lassen, damit du keine drei proxmox Hosts benötigst.

Hier gibt's eine Anleitung für'n raspi
https://www.apalrd.net/posts/2022/cluster_qdevice/

wergor

connoisseur de mimi
Avatar
Registered: Jul 2005
Location: vulkanland
Posts: 4111
ich hab mir einen container für meinen unifi controller angelegt und ihm beim erstellen die ip 1.111 gegeben. wenn ich das web interface vom controller aufrufen will muss ich aber die ip vom pve server angeben (1.106). weis jemand was es damit auf sich hat?
screenshot-from-2025-01-15-08-54-25_274393.png

wergor

connoisseur de mimi
Avatar
Registered: Jul 2005
Location: vulkanland
Posts: 4111
benutzt hier jemand proxmox backup server zumsammen mit dem proxmox backup client programm? ich bin grad nicht sicher wie ich das backup meines homeservers richtig angeh. ordnerstruktur ist in etwa:
Code:
.
├── home
│   └── wergor
├── storage
│   ├── home
│   ├── stuff
│   ├── lost+found
│   ├── music
│   ├── nextcloud
│   └── pr0n
├── sys
└── anderer linux kram
wobei storage ein raid5 ist.
angefangen hab ich damit für jedes wichtige dir unter /storage/ einen backup job auszuführen (will nicht den ganzen /storage sichern), jetzt schaut der datastore am pbs so aus:
screenshot-from-2025-01-16-20-27-53_274440.png

ich bin mir aber nicht sicher ob das so passt, vor allem weil der pbs angefangen hat die backups, beginnend mit dem ersten dir das ich backupd habe, zu löschen >:(

Code:
2025-01-12T00:00:00+01:00: prune job 'default-backup-ab1205d8-9fd1-40d'
2025-01-12T00:00:00+01:00: task triggered by schedule 'daily'
2025-01-12T00:00:00+01:00: Starting datastore prune on datastore 'backup', root namespace, down to full depth
2025-01-12T00:00:00+01:00: retention options: --keep-daily 14 --keep-monthly 6 --keep-yearly 10
2025-01-12T00:00:00+01:00: Pruning group :"host/homeserver"
2025-01-12T00:00:00+01:00: remove host/homeserver/2025-01-11T13:43:46Z
2025-01-12T00:00:00+01:00: removing backup snapshot "/mnt/backups/host/homeserver/2025-01-11T13:43:46Z"
2025-01-12T00:00:00+01:00: remove host/homeserver/2025-01-11T18:05:16Z
2025-01-12T00:00:00+01:00: removing backup snapshot "/mnt/backups/host/homeserver/2025-01-11T18:05:16Z"
2025-01-12T00:00:00+01:00: remove host/homeserver/2025-01-11T21:21:23Z
2025-01-12T00:00:00+01:00: removing backup snapshot "/mnt/backups/host/homeserver/2025-01-11T21:21:23Z"
2025-01-12T00:00:01+01:00: keep host/homeserver/2025-01-11T21:50:47Z
2025-01-12T00:00:01+01:00: keep-partial host/homeserver/2025-01-11T22:10:53Z
2025-01-12T00:00:01+01:00: queued notification (id=a0cccf7f-f3c9-46de-a290-eff4390e83af)
2025-01-12T00:00:01+01:00: TASK OK
dann noch der daily garbage collect und futsch waren die ersten backups.

man kann mit dem backup client auch mehrere archives und directories auf einmal angeben, dann schaut der datastore z.b. so aus:
screenshot-from-2025-01-16-20-33-33_274441.png

bei music musste er nix machen, das hatte ich vorher schon mal backupd (wie home und nextcloud im screenshot oben) und hat sich nicht geändert, also zumindest scheint es egal zu sein ob man mehrer aufrufe vom client mit jeweils einem directory oder einen aufruf mit mehreren dirs macht.

mache ich das was offensichtliches falsch?

nexus_VI

Overnumerousness!
Avatar
Registered: Aug 2006
Location: südstadt
Posts: 3769
Wenn du mehr Backups aufheben willst, musst du eine Rotation beim entsprechenden Prune Job festlegen.
Beispiel:
click to enlarge

wergor

connoisseur de mimi
Avatar
Registered: Jul 2005
Location: vulkanland
Posts: 4111
was meinst genau?
so schaut mein job jetzt aus (deaktiviert bis ich das problem gelöst habe)
screenshot-from-2025-01-17-10-47-44_274452.png

die alten (problematischen) settings sind oben im log

nexus_VI

Overnumerousness!
Avatar
Registered: Aug 2006
Location: südstadt
Posts: 3769
Ich bezieh mich auf
Zitat
ich bin mir aber nicht sicher ob das so passt, vor allem weil der pbs angefangen hat die backups, beginnend mit dem ersten dir das ich backupd habe, zu löschen >:(
Mit den settings sollten die Backups eigentlich nicht verschwinden. 10 Jahre mag etwas lang sein :D

Oder was ist sonst das konkrete Problem?

Master99

verträumter realist
Avatar
Registered: Jul 2001
Location: vie/grz
Posts: 12693
was regelt 'keep last'?
könnte '3' hier nicht bedeutet dass beim 4x ausführen dann #1 gelöscht wird?
Kontakt | Unser Forum | Über overclockers.at | Impressum | Datenschutz